Output c90d6056a03de127d29397d77997c70f1ff333053f0ac888e951f96f275cc705:0

value
3585880767
script pubkey
OP_0 OP_PUSHBYTES_20 3debb0a99297d7c7962a1eb48f1f316e27694f04
address
tb1q8h4mp2vjjltu0932r66g78e3dcnkjncyu9jzea
transaction
c90d6056a03de127d29397d77997c70f1ff333053f0ac888e951f96f275cc705
confirmations
111601
spent
true